Programs

The Friends provide financial support and volunteers for the following programs:

  • World Wide Knit in Public Day: People come from all over to knit in public. Blankets, hats, and scarves are donated to foster kids, newborns, people transitioning from homeless into housing, and other people needing assistance

  • Summer Reading Program: Children earn points for reading and completing activities. Prizes at the end.

 
  • Spanish Book Club

  • Day of the Dead: Celebrates life and death and honors those deceased with colorful altar exhibits, poetry readings, sugar skull making, Folklorico and Aztec dancing, Mariachi music, face painting.  


The Friends host community events:

 
  • Author Events

  • Downtown Architectural Walking tours every Saturday at 10:00 am starting at the train depot and ending at the Michael Graves designed post-modern San Juan Capistrano library.


The Friends support Library Events:

  • Tuesday Storytime includes stories, songs, movement, and activities to help children prepare for and succeed in school.
